C3H8 + 5O2 ==> 3CO2 +4H2O
mols Propane = grams/molar mass = estimated 0.34.
Convert mols propane to mols CO2 and mols H2O, then apply the following. You will need to look up the values for dH of CO2 and H2O(liquid) and C3H8. dH for O2 = 0
Post your work if you get stuck.
dHrxn = (n*dH products) - (n*dH reactants)
